Armycaptin Hanover strikes again

Armycaptin Hanover (Captaintreacherous) extended his reign over the top harness racing class at Fraser Downs on Monday (Jun. 20) with a fourth consecutive victory in the Open.

He raced in third position for Kelly Hoerdt through :27.1 and :56.4 first-half splits and launched his winning first-over move as they approached three-quarters in 1:24.4. Mach Steady (John Abbott) put up futile resistance from the lead, but Armycaptin Hanover muscled past to a half-length victory in 1:53.

Kootenay Santanna (David Kelly) slid up the pylons to take second. Mach Steady held show.

The win price was $5.60.

Hoerdt trains Armycaptin Hanover and owns the six-year-old with Blair Corbeil. The gelding has won 26 times and raked in $171,851 in 92 attempts. He is five-for-15 this year.

Moosette (Hes Watching) won the Fillies and Mares Open with Scott Knight in the sulky. The five-year-old mare moved first-over from fifth in the third quarter and clawed herself to the front as they entered the stretch to score by a length-and-a-quarter in 1:56.

Mystic Shadow (Bradley Watt) was second over Bohemiam Rhapsody (John Abbott). Win backers got back $3.10.

The mare has won 18 of her 52 career starts and has earned $134,028. Jim Marino trains the Shale Stables homebred.

Knight bagged five winners on the 13-race evening.

Racing at Fraser Downs returns on Monday, Jun. 27. It will be the track’s final card until September.
